Strawberry Soil Requirements: Understanding What Strawberries Need
Strawberries, like all plants, have specific needs when it comes to their growing environment. One of the most crucial factors is the soil they're planted in. Strawberries thrive in well-drained, slightly acidic soil. Ideal soil p H ranges from 5.5 to
6.8. This acidity helps the plants absorb essential nutrients. The soil structure also plays a vital role. Strawberries need soil that's loose and loamy, allowing their roots to spread easily and access water and nutrients effectively. Heavy, compacted soil can restrict root growth and lead to various problems.
Beyond p H and soil texture, drainage is paramount. Strawberries are susceptible to root rot, a fungal disease that thrives in overly wet conditions. Therefore, the soil must drain well, allowing excess water to move away from the roots quickly. This doesn't mean the soil should be bone dry; it should retain enough moisture to keep the plants hydrated but not waterlogged. The balance between moisture retention and drainage is key to healthy strawberry growth.
The Problem with Damp Soil and Strawberries: Root Rot and Other Issues
So,can strawberries grow in damp soil? The short answer is: not well. While strawberries need consistent moisture, damp soil, particularly consistently damp soil, is a recipe for disaster. Damp soil is often poorly drained soil, which means the water sits around the roots for extended periods. This creates an environment ripe for fungal diseases, the most common and deadly of which is root rot. Root rot is caused by various fungi, including Phytophthoraand Rhizoctonia, which attack and destroy the roots, preventing the plant from absorbing water and nutrients. As a result, the plant wilts, turns yellow, and eventually dies.
The dangers ofgrowing strawberries in excessively damp soilextend beyond root rot. Other problems include:
- Increased susceptibility to other diseases: Damp conditions favor the growth of other fungal and bacterial pathogens that can attack the leaves, stems, and fruits of strawberry plants.
- Nutrient deficiencies: Waterlogged soil can interfere with nutrient uptake, even if the nutrients are present in the soil. This is because the roots need oxygen to absorb nutrients effectively, and damp soil often lacks sufficient oxygen.
- Reduced fruit production: Stressed plants are less productive. Strawberries grown in damp soil may produce fewer fruits, and the fruits may be smaller and of lower quality.
- Attraction of pests: Damp conditions can attract certain pests, such as slugs and snails, which can damage strawberry plants and fruits.
Identifying Damp Soil: How to Know if Your Soil is Too Wet for Strawberries
It's crucial to be able to identify damp soil to prevent problems before they start. Here are some signs that your soil may be too wet for strawberries:
- Standing water: This is the most obvious sign. If you see water pooling on the surface of the soil, it's a clear indication of poor drainage.
- Soil that stays wet for extended periods: Even after rainfall, the soil should dry out within a reasonable amount of time. If it remains soggy for days, it's likely too damp.
- Musty smell: Damp soil often has a characteristic musty or moldy odor, which is a sign of fungal activity.
- Algae or moss growth: The presence of algae or moss on the soil surface indicates excessive moisture.
- Slow plant growth: If your strawberry plants are growing slowly or not at all, it could be due to damp soil conditions.
- Yellowing leaves: This is a common symptom of root rot and other problems associated with damp soil.
Improving Soil Drainage for Strawberries: Creating the Ideal Growing Environment
If you suspect your soil is too damp for strawberries, don't despair! There are several things you can do to improve drainage and create a healthier growing environment. Here are some effective strategies:
Amend the Soil with Organic Matter
Adding organic matter, such as compost, well-rotted manure, or peat moss, can significantly improve soil drainage. Organic matter helps to loosen the soil, creating air pockets that allow water to drain more freely. It also improves the soil's structure and water-holding capacity, striking the crucial balance between drainage and moisture retention. Aim to incorporate a generous amount of organic matter into the soil before planting your strawberries, and continue to amend the soil regularly throughout the growing season.
Raised Beds or Containers: A Practical Solution for Damp Soil
Growing strawberries in raised beds or containers is an excellent way to overcome drainage problems. Raised beds elevate the planting area, allowing water to drain away more easily. Containers provide even more control over drainage, as you can choose a well-draining potting mix and ensure that the container has adequate drainage holes. This is especially helpful if you have heavy clay soil or live in an area with frequent rainfall.
Improve Soil Structure
If your soil is compacted, it can be difficult for water to drain properly. Tilling or digging the soil can help to loosen it up and improve drainage. Consider using a garden fork or tiller to break up compacted soil before planting. You can also add amendments like perlite or vermiculite to further improve soil structure.
Proper Watering Techniques: Finding the Balance
Even with well-drained soil, it's important to water your strawberries correctly. Avoid overwatering, and allow the soil to dry out slightly between waterings. Water deeply but infrequently, rather than shallowly and frequently. This encourages the roots to grow deeper, making the plants more drought-tolerant and less susceptible to root rot. Use a soaker hose or drip irrigation to deliver water directly to the roots, minimizing water loss and reducing the risk of foliar diseases.
Consider the Location: Sun Exposure Matters
Ensure your strawberry plants receive adequate sunlight. Sunlight helps to dry out the soil and reduce humidity, creating a less favorable environment for fungal diseases. Aim for at least six hours of sunlight per day. Also, choose a location with good air circulation, which helps to dry the leaves and reduce the risk of foliar diseases.
Choosing the Right Strawberry Varieties: Some Are More Tolerant
While all strawberries prefer well-drained soil, some varieties are more tolerant of damp conditions than others. Researching and selecting varieties known for their disease resistance can give you a better chance of success, even if your soil isn't perfectly ideal. Some examples include:
- 'Chandler': Known for its vigor and resistance to certain diseases.
- 'Earliglow': A popular early-season variety with good disease resistance.
- 'Honeoye': A productive variety that's relatively tolerant of a range of soil conditions.
Consult with your local nursery or agricultural extension office for recommendations on the best strawberry varieties for your specific climate and soil conditions.
